Provide constant heat for moxibustion. Easy to light.
Super pure fine quality moxa stick, excellent in warm stimulation and moxibustion. 12 cm long x 1 cm dia.
Precautions:
1. The moxa is not allowed to burn down to the skin for children.
2. Do not burn moxa on points in the inflamed area. Select proximal and distal points for inflammation.
3. If it not recommended that put moxa on the face, because of the risk of scarring.
4. Do not treat the patient who is very hungry or has just eaten a big meal.
5. Do not treat the patient who is in very serious cases. For example, serious cancer, high fever or fatigue.
6. For pregnant or possible pregnant woman, do not apply moxa to the lower abdomen.
7. Do not apply moxa to the patient who took hot bath or sauna an hour before or after.
8. Do not apply moxa to the patient who took alcohol, sleep-inducing drugs or nacrotics.
9. Do not apply moxa over large blood vessel.
